Explain the phrase – “Unity is Strength” on the basis of the making of fabric from fibre.

उत्तर
Fibre is a thin hair-like strand. A large number of fibres are used to make fabric. The phrase – “Unity is strength” can be used in this regard because a single fibre can be easily pulled and broken whereas fabric needs more energy to tear apart.
